# Magicat - A LaTeX Template **Repository Path**: daohengdao/magicat ## Basic Information - **Project Name**: Magicat - A LaTeX Template - **Description**: Magicat is a LaTeX template based on XeTeX, which can be used in multiple editors such as Overleaf (in the form of document class file). - **Primary Language**: TeX/LaTeX - **License**: CC-BY-4.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 1 - **Created**: 2023-05-13 - **Last Updated**: 2023-05-13 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README #### 简介 **魔法猫猫**(英:Magicat)是一个基于XeLaTeX的LaTeX模板,本作品采用知识共享署名4.0国际许可协议,您可以在不违反此协议的基础上随意使用本模板,包括但不限于: 1. 本体文件,即`.cls`文件,您可以将文件放在目录中来使用本模板; 2. 源代码,本模板中的任意代码在不违反此协议的基础上都可以随意参考取用; 3. 指南书,包括`.pdf`文件与其相应的源代码在不违反此协议的基础上都可以随意参考取用; 本文旨在对本模板的安装,使用与配置等具体情况进行说明。 #### 使用方式 若您使用 _Overleaf_ ,则您需要使用 _XeTeX_ 来编译文件(不可使用除此以外的其他方式,例如 _pdfTeX_ 与 _LuaTeX_ 等),调用的方式与一般的文档类相同。 若您使用 _TeXLive_ ,则您可能需要检查宏包的运行情况与字体的加载情况等问题,当存在宏包丢失等类似问题时,您可以按照以下方式利用命令行进行排查: 1. 运行 `tlmgr update --all` ; 2. 运行 `tlmgr update --self` ; 3. 运行 `tlmgr update --self --all --reinstall -forcibly -removed`; 若您使用其他平台,则您可在此处对具体遇到的问题进行反馈。 #### 版本分类 这个仓库存储的内容是各个版本的魔法猫猫,具体分类如下: 1. 在v1.5版本之前,版本号的格式为`Magicat version`,对应的指南书位于`guidebook[v1.0-v.1.5]`; 2. 在v1.6版本及之后版本,魔法猫猫分为`classic`与`extended`两个分支版本,版本号的格式不变,但使用`Magicat-version-type`来对文件等作区别,对应的指南书位于`guidebook[v1.6+]`文件夹中; #### 注意事项 在使用本模板时,请务必注意以下问题: 1. 对于`classic`分支,在文档类选项`mode=math`时不可使用`unicode-math`宏包,否则会因为字体问题导致自定义符号失效; 2. 不建议修改`extended`分支的源代码,因为这可能造成许多问题,本模板的维护重心也是`classic`分支而非`extended`分支; 3. 对于指南书的更新一般跟随维护,在存在大变动的版本进行相关更新。